your event (and everything else in your class) is specific to
class instances. no two instances can communicate with each other
directly.
you can create another class that contains references to them
all, but that won't get you any further than using each instance to
get to the root timeline which then allows access to the others.
there are several strategies for increasing efficiency of
hitTests. i like to use a grid.
imagine the stage divided into a grid. if your objects are
not changing position with time t, you have an easy task. if they
change position with time, you'll have more work to do.
but for each time t, each grid contains a list of objects
within it. for each time t, each object has a property referencing
the grid within which it's contained.
when you want to perform a hittest for a particular object,
check its grid. then execute a hittest against all objects in that
grid and the eight (assuming rectangular shaped) surrounding grids.
there are several strategies for picking a grid size. but, in
general, you don't want grids to be so small that when you check
for collisions, you have to check beyond the surrounding 8 plus the
center grid.

  • Custom Event for Purchase Requisition Create, Change & Delete

    Hello Experts,
    I want to create a custom event which triggers on Purchase Requisition Create, SAP provide's standard event's for purchase requisition release but not for create.
    What are all the steps and how to create a new event.
    Thanks in Adavance,
    Sandhya.

    Hi Sandhya,
    may i know the reason why you are trying to create custom methods.
    You have business object BUS2009(for PR line item wise release) and BUS2105(for PR overall release).
    Both those business object have events RELEASESTEPCREATED (for PR creation) and SIGNIFICANTLYCHANGED(For PR change).
    Even then if you want to create custom events, create a subtype of the standard business object, then click on events, and then select create. Now create your Z-events, say ZCREATED (For creation), ZCHANGED (for changed) and ZDELETED (for deleted). Now select each event, click on edit -> Change release status -> object type component -> to be implemented. Follow the same for all the events. Then select each event, click on edit -> Change release status -> object type component -> to be released.
    Now click on your custom object, click on edit -> Change release status -> object type component -> to be implemented.Then click on your custom object, click on edit -> Change release status -> object type component -> to be released.
    After this in SWEC tcode, click on new entries. Select change document object as BANF, business object as say ZBUS2105 and event as ZCREATED. make sure radio button on create is checked.
    Similary create entries for ZCHANGED event and ZDELETED.
    Select on change and on delete radio button for event ZCHANGED and ZDELETED event respectively.

    Hi Venkat,
    <b>Workflow triggers here and routes it to 3 approvers.</b>
    From this i understand that you have three activity steps in parallel using a fork. Right? Or do u mean to say the same workitem has three agents and is delivered to three peoples inbox. If you are delivering the same work item to three inboxes there is no way that you can have it in other agents inboxes after being processed by one agent. In fact immediately after the first agent opens the workitem for processing it will disappear from the inbox of other agents.
    But <b>if you are using three steps in parallel under a fork.</b> Yes you can achieve this.
    <u><b>Section 1:</b></u>
    You have already created a ZEDIT method and made the method as synchronous. Hence you must have made the task also as synchronous (checkbox "Synchronous object method" checked). Now goto the "Terminating Events" tab of the task. If you still have the terminating event here just delete it. You will not need this as your workitem will get automatically completed when the BO method is executed once.
    Now assign this task to the three activities (for three agents) under the fork step. Now when a workitem is created for this task you will get the workitems in all three inboxes (These will be three individual workitems belonging to each activity inside the fork). Now each of these workitems are independent of each other and will not affect other workitems based on its own processing status.
    <u><b>
    Section 2:</b></u>
    If you have reached till above your approvers will be able to process the workitem independent of each other. Now again you will have a problem here. Once you have made your task as synchronous it just waits for the execution of the BO method and it does not know whether you have achieved the purpose of the method. In your case your objective is to edit the document. But if your approver executes the workitem once it will bring him to CV02N. Now assume he wants to edit the document later and he presses the "BACK" button. Your objective is not completed but still your BO method will get completed and hence terminate the workitem of that approver. To avoid this you need to get back the sy-ucomm value for BACK into your BO  method and write a few lines of code such that your workitem will not get terminated when BACK is pressed. This can be done using some BADI's available for this transaction.
